Fire fighting robot communication control

      business background

      Underground multi-storey buildings have complex structures, thick concrete steel walls, and many underground metal reflection sources. Existing wireless communication equipment has small signal coverage, large signal loss and fading, and poor resistance to multipath effects when used in such complex environments. Shortcomings such as limited bandwidth cannot completely solve the problem of stable transmission of information. The establishment of a broadband emergency communication system capable of stably transmitting video and audio in the underground building complex to respond to emergencies and realize image detection of complex underground environments has always been valued by the fire department, and it is also one of the problems that the communications industry needs to overcome.

      After years of hard work, the underground emergency communication equipment of the new MESH fire-fighting robot communication control system has solved the problem of underground emergency communication. At the same time, the system products have the characteristics of simple installation, flexible use, simple operation, etc., and can be widely used in public security, fire protection, civil air defense, armed police, troops, electric power, petroleum, transportation and other departments.


      An Introduction

      Long-distance emergency communication solution The underground emergency communication system is mainly composed of WiFi module Mesh individual image transmission, Mesh repeater, Mesh base station and corresponding individual image transmission, headset, handheld microphone, interface cable and other accessories. It is a kind of A mobile broadband wireless communication transmission system designed with a brand-new "wireless mesh network" concept. The system adopts the same-frequency networking technology, supports multi-hop relay, and each node can move randomly, and the route can be quickly reconstructed when the system topology changes rapidly. The communication system uses the multi-hop relay of Mesh equipment to create a stable broadband communication link between internal attackers and the on-site command, realizes the real-time transmission of on-site audio, video and data information, and realizes visualized command and dispatch. In addition, the information of the communication command vehicle can also be transmitted back to the command center through 5G LTE private network, 5G public network or satellite communication network.


      Program features

      ◆Software radio architecture It adopts a general hardware platform, supports dynamic loading and unloading of waveforms, and can configure parameters such as operating frequency, bandwidth, transmit power, modulation rate and network topology online according to changes in actual channel conditions and user status.

      ◆Broadband Mesh ad hoc network does not rely on base stations, efficiently and quickly form a centerless wireless broadband network. It supports multi-hop relay, which can effectively expand the coverage radius of the wireless network.

      ◆The WiFi module network has the characteristics of automatic routing, self-organization, self-healing, and automatic realization of chain, star and other network topologies.

      ◆One machine with multi-mode, ready to use any node device can be used as an information collection node, relay node or information output node at the same time.

      ◆All-IP networking, easy to interconnect, provide IP interface, can realize interconnection with other IP equipment.

      ◆Convergent communication hybrid networking, with both a central 5G LTE private network command network and a non-centralized MESH ad hoc front-end combat network. The WiFi module long-distance emergency communication solution not only solves the underground mutual communication in complex environments The difficult problem of coordinated operations has also solved the need for the back-end command to understand the progress of forward operations in real time.
